The United Kingdom: New Document Legalization Fees for 2024
Key Points
- The United Kingdom will increase fees associated with the legalization of public documents beginning in 2024
Overview
The United Kingdom (UK) government will increase fees for legalizing public documents beginning 1 January 2024. Legalized documents are needed in many international transactions, including overseas working visas. These changes will include the following:
Service | Current fee up to 31 December 2023 | New fee from 1 January 2024 |
Standard service in the UK (plus postal costs) | £30 | £45 |
Standard (Next-Day) | £30 | £40 |
Digital e-Apostille | £30 | £35 |
Urgent service in the UK | £75 | £100 |
Overseas service (in addition to indirect costs, if any) | £30 | £40 |
According to the government, consular office fees may also increase at the discretion of officials within each location.
